Ingredients

  • 2 teaspoons peanut oil
  • 600 grams lean beef mince
  • 250 gram can mild satay sauce
  • 1 carrot, medium, peeled
  • 4 green onions
  • 1 yellow capsicum chopped
  • 8 iceberg lettuce leaves, trimmed
  • white rice, steamed to serve

Recipe's preparation

  1. Chop carrot for 6 seconds on speed 6.  Remove from TM Bowl.

  2. Chop green onions for 6 seconds on speed 6.  Remove from TM Bowl.

  3. Put oil and mince in TM bowl.  Cook for 10 minutes at varoma temperature on Counter-clockwise operation"Counter-clockwise operation" , Gentle stir setting"Gentle stir setting" placing basket instead of MC on TM bowl lid.

  4. Add carrot, onion, capsicum and sauce and cook for 15 minutes at 100C on Counter-clockwise operation"Counter-clockwise operation" , Gentle stir setting"Gentle stir setting"  placing basket instead of MC on TM bowl lid.

  5. Spoon into lettuce leaves and serve with rice.
